Evolutionary theories frequently emphasize that humans have adapted to their physical environment. One such theory hypothesizes that people must spontaneously follow a 24-hour cycle of sleeping as well as waking-even if they aren't exposed to the usual pattern of sunlight. To test this notion, eight paid volunteers were placed (individually) in the room in which there was no light from the outside as well as no clocks or other indications of time. They could turn lights on and off as they wished. After a month in the room, each individual tended to develop a steady cycle. Their cycles at the end of study were as follows: 25, 27, 25, 23, 24, 25, 26, and 25.

Using the .05 level of significance, what should we conclude regarding the theory that 24 hours is the natural cycle? (That is, does the average cycle length under these situations differ significantly from 24 hours?) (a) Employ the steps of hypothesis testing. (b) Sketch the distributions involved, (c) Discuss your answer to someone who has never taken the course in statistics.
